On that day in 1959, the United Nations General Assembly adopted the Declaration of the Rights of the Child, and in 1989 it adopted the Convention on the Rights of the Child that obliges all countries to provide a good life and a happy childhood for children.

This Day is dedicated to protecting the rights of children throughout the world. Children are the meaning of life, they are our future.
